Activities at Hagley Place Care Home

Activities plays a big part in the care we deliver to residents; activities staff are committed to organising a mix of activities and events for residents and the local community to get involved in, including trips out to local places of interest in our minibus and visits from entertainers and musicians. It is important to us that each individual who we support can get as much from these as possible, so we try our best to arrange activities that reflect their interests and capabilities as best as possible, and encourage them to participate in any way they can. We also encourage relatives to join in with activities and events as often as they can.

What do you know?

What do you know?

Residents and staff had a puzzling afternoon during Hagley Place’s big quiz! The quiz sparked discussions about travel, food, literature, shared experiences and much more, including some surprising stories. Residents and staff both shared their history and tales, including their first holiday, first trip to see a live performance, learning how to make bread and more.

Remembrance Day

Staff at Hagley made Remembrance Day extra special this year by decorating the lounge and inviting residents to gather to watch the service on the television together. It was a very emotional time for everyone, but the care and respect shown to honour the fallen was well received.

Indoor Street Party

Residents, staff and the public had a proper knees up at Hagley’s Indoor Street Party! The live Glenn Miller band went down a treat and the traditional food from the '40s was relished. Everyone had a rip-roaring good time, including the staff, who went the extra step and dressed up for the occasion! Zara, our Head Chef, made an amazing two tier cake that was hand-decorated with poppies!
